Double Recognition for Bread Street
The annual awards, which have celebrated excellence in the city’s design since 1966, highlighted our transformative work on Bread Street, one of Wakefield’s oldest and most historic thoroughfares.
Residential Adaptation:
Fibre Construction received a commendation for converting an old commercial property on Bread Street into a unique single home. The Civic Society judges praised the project as an “imaginative adaptation for residential use”.
Best Shop Front:
Our company chief, Matt Focarelli, also received a commendation in the “Best Shop Front” category. This award recognises the careful restoration of traditional façades that celebrate the street’s heritage.
Contributing to Wakefield’s Regeneration
The Bread Street project was part of a wider improvement scheme that benefited from a shop front grant from Wakefield Council. Our work focused on restoring the fabric of these historic buildings to ensure they serve a modern purpose while retaining their original character.
Civic Society President Kevin Trickett noted that this year’s awards focused on “quality over quantity,” highlighting how developers like Fibre Construction are helping to enhance the city centre. By converting old commercial spaces into vibrant homes, we are proud to be part of the trend of people moving back into the heart of Wakefield, providing a boost to local businesses and the community.
